    2-Substituted benzimidazoles 3a-c was prepared via condensation of ethyl pyruvates 2a-c with 2-phenylenediamine in glacial acetic acid. Pyrrolo[1,2-a]benzimidazole derivatives 5 and 8 were prepared via cyclocondensation of compounds 3a,b with phosphorus oxychloride or acetic anhydride in presence of sodium acetate respectively. Reactivity of pyruvate 2 towards 2-aminophenol, hydroxylamine and cyanothioacetamide was also investigated. They exhibited potent antimicrobial activity comparable to clinical drugs such as ciprofloxacin and ketoconazole. Compounds 3a, 11 and 13 showed excellent antimicrobial activity against all the tested microbes, and Compound 11 showed lower MIC values against all the tested organisms
